What is SimulTrain?

SimulTrain is a Project Management Simulator used in project management training programs. SimulTrain is a simulation of the planning and execution phases of a medium-sized project, that involves all of the events that occur.

SimulTrain is a computer-based multimedia tool which allows the participants to learn:

to structure a project; to control the progress of a project; to use project management tools.

Training is done in small groups of 3-4 people in a period of 6-10 hours. The simulator confronts the groups with situations very different in nature and often requiring quick decisions. The participants thus learn how to work and make decisions as a team.

The simulator involves multimedia technology: the participants receive phone calls, e-mails and voice-mails, thus surrounding them in a realistic project atmosphere.

At the end of the simulation, the trainees assess their mistakes and the lessons they learned individually as well as in the group.
